Type I

Type I One of he most risky and dangerous diabetes is the Type I diabetes. In this disease the pancreas creates a very little amount of insulin and sometimes creates nothing which is the worst condition. This diabetes occurs usually in the children below twenty years of age, like children or young adults.

In the type I diabetes many scientists consider that the cells of pancreas are assaulted due to which they stop doing their function and the person face a lot of problems.

 

Whereas other scientists consider that the viral disease affects the immune system which starts to attack the pancreas and eventually pancreas stops their function. Proper medication and diet is a must when suffering from type I diabetes.

Type II

Type II diabetes is the most famous type of all and it is the most common as well. It occurs in the overweight or obese persons and attacks when they are older. It is said that about ninety percent of diabetes cases are of Type II Diabetes. Sometimes it is also seen that children and young adults are affected by this disease but the reason is that they have very less physical activity.

It is seen that the type II diabetes occurs usually to the person having unhealthy lifestyle. Like obese body and no physical activity or exercises.

Gestational or Diabetes Pregnancy

The third major type of diabetes is the Gestational Diabetes. It is also known as the Diabetes Pregnancy. Women may affect by this disease when they are in their third or fourth month of pregnancy. It is estimated that almost four percent of all women who are pregnant will have the diabetes pregnancy or gestational diabetes. The above described two types, type I and type II will remain with the person for many years and sometimes life time but the gestational diabetes will vanish just after the birth of the child.
